Transaction 33af268336ee5ceef191ff7770bdc7755a85c908bf54c26cbca4bcc5f640995d

1 Input
2 Outputs
  • 33af268336ee5ceef191ff7770bdc7755a85c908bf54c26cbca4bcc5f640995d:0
  • value  100000
    address  3EokUDtdrbCNxE6PwFUR8rmB1PLpRXJWuQ
  • 33af268336ee5ceef191ff7770bdc7755a85c908bf54c26cbca4bcc5f640995d:1
  • value  2615356
    address  bc1qz68qchkvrkpg00228kgaaqhj5ryptdz7flzndk